QWhat is the difference between individual and group behavior?

Explanation
Individual behavior refers to the actions of a single person, while group behavior refers to the actions of a collective. Individual behavior can be influenced by personality traits, attitudes, and motivation, while group behavior can be influenced by social norms, roles, and leadership.
